    I use Stream deck to open up 3rd party plugins on a chosen track and it saves me hours a day. I have 20-30 of my favorite plugins programmed via Keyboard maestro on Stream deck and now I don’t go scrolling through menus anymore.. game changer.

    Cool tips, thanks :) One suggestion though that I find more opti overall if you have a lot of profiles is to replace the bottom right key by a folder on every page/profile and this folder content is always the same with shortcuts to directly open the specific profiles/pages that you want. (Yes, it's one clic more when you just wanted the next profile, but it's a lot of clics less than if you have to cycle through 4-10+ pages)

    Great video. The Stream Deck is amazing for production, but I also use it to control smart home devices like lights and switches; the IFTTT integration allows you to do this. You can turn your PC on/off using the Steam Deck through various integrations as well. Overall, super useful device.
